Runbook: Scanline barcode bridge

If warehouse scans stop flowing into Cartwheel, it's almost always the bridge service on the Dunmore floor box wedging after a USB hiccup. Bounce the service first — nine times out of ten that fixes it. If not, check the queue depth before escalating. When restarting, make sure the bridge comes up with these settings.

deployment values, yafop-bajef:
[gilok]
team = ulaius
access_code = ac_423664
host = gilok.sivrelhq.corp
port = 9200
owner = pelius.istax
peer = eliok.torvasoft.internal

Subject: Paylune retries now require idempotency keys

Plugin authors: starting with the next Paylune SDK release, every payment retry must carry the same idempotency key as the original attempt. Mismatched keys will be rejected, not deduplicated. Update your retry wrappers before the cutover; the compatibility shim is removed in this release. The release is pinned to the build identified below.

build token for hafop-fawif: htk31_9758d5e565aa3b14f55d629377373c4

## Log Compaction Basics

Brineway compacts queue segments once a topic exceeds its retention threshold, keeping only the latest record per key. Plugin authors must not assume intermediate records survive a compaction pass; design consumers to tolerate gaps. Compaction timing is broker-controlled and not configurable per plugin. Full segment lifecycle details are on the internal compaction reference page.

runbook for hawif-tajeg: https://grafana.plorvasoft.example/dash

Runbook: Contrast Audit Pass — Glimmerbird UI

The automated color-contrast audit runs nightly against the Glimmerbird component library, flagging any text pair below the 4.5:1 threshold. Failures block the publish pipeline until acknowledged. Reviewers should confirm the scanner itself has not been tampered with before trusting results. The scanner reads its thresholds and target hosts from the values below.

config for kaweg-bageg:
RALDOR_PIN=4996
RALDOR_METRICS_HOST=metrics.raldor.nelvroworks.corp
RALDOR_LOG_LEVEL=error
RALDOR_TENANT=wenir